Job Summary
The Medical Coding Auditor is responsible for reviewing medical coding accuracy and documentation integrity, ensuring compliance with federal and state regulations, payer guidelines, and internal policies.
Key responsibilities include performing coding audits, completing compliance accuracy score tracking, trending, and monitoring, and providing feedback and education to billers, coders, and providers.
The role requires a strong background in Microsoft Office applications and experience with EMR/EHR systems, encoders, and auditing tools.
